The New Media and Technology Law Blog, published by Proskauer Rose LLP, focuses on legal issues at the intersection of technology, media, and emerging digital trends. It covers topics such as data licensing and restrictions, artificial intelligence and generative AI implications, privacy and cybersecurity regulations, online platform liability, electronic contracting and enforceability of website terms, and evolving state and federal data privacy laws. The blog also discusses recent court decisions affecting technology law, including interpretations of statutes like the Computer Fraud and Abuse Act and the Communications Decency Act. It serves as a resource for understanding how legal frameworks adapt to innovations in technology and digital media.
